Possible allergy: While generally safe, this procedure can be complicated by allergy to the contrast embolus causing a stroke dissection of the artery causing a stroke perforation of a vessel causing bleeding at the site of the insertion of the catheter or more distally damage to the vessel at site of insertion of the catheter requiring surgical repair.

Brain angio: Depending on the health of the pt there can be risks of bleeding, stroke, kidney damage, allergic reaction, death etc. Usually the condition requiring an angiogram is more concerning.
